Nintendo teases internet with Metroid Prime content 

metroid-prime

Earlier today Nintendo launched a new Japanese site for Metroid Prime, featuring a peek at two Wiimakes and Metroid Prime Corruption. At the bottom of the page there is some text stating "Another Side Story coming soon" and, "The Metroid Prime history followed from the perspective of a space pirate".

IGN thinks that the new stuff will be nothing more than "web-based content detailing a side story", but fans can always hope for more.

Japanese gamers will be getting the New Play Control version of Metroid Prime on February 19.
